**Audit item 7: Alertfold dedup checks.** Quick one for the sync — confirm the on-call alert deduplicator isn't collapsing distinct pager incidents with matching titles but different clusters. We saw one near-miss last week. Verify the fingerprint config includes the cluster tag and that suppression windows are under five minutes. Flag anything weird before Thursday. The person to ping about this is:

named custodian: Brivan Eliath Quenox Frador

Cleaning crews from Verlan Services attend the Ashgrove building nightly between 22:00 and 02:00. Night-shift staff should confirm each cleaner is wearing a Verlan tabard and check the crew count against the roster pinned at the security desk. Cleaners may access all floors except the records room on level two, which stays locked overnight. Report any unlisted personnel to the duty supervisor before granting entry. The service entrance on Pelham Lane remains bolted; cleaners are admitted using the code below.

staff pass of kawip-hawef = bdg-QLP-2

Welcome to the Quillpress team! Quillpress is our PDF invoice renderer — it takes billing payloads from Ledgerbird and spits out tidy PDFs. Most days you'll just tweak templates. If the render worker's service account ever gets wedged, you'll need to re-auth it before the weekly sync demo. Use the recovery passphrase noted directly below to unlock it.

unlock words, hahip-yagef: zorok-novmir-zorix-silax

Re: Hermodbuild migration for the Quartzline service. Cache hits are at 91% after pinning the toolchain; remaining flakiness traces to the codegen step pulling ambient env vars. I stripped those and declared them as explicit inputs. Remote execution on the Fenwick cluster is stable. Remaining work: sandbox the proto plugin. For the sync, note that build times now depend heavily on the constants below.

limits module of bawef-bajep:
CAPS = {
    "novvan": 877,
    "quenvan": 327,
}